#7077da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7077da is composed of 43.9% red, 46.7%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.6% cyan, 45.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 236 degrees, a saturation of 58.9% and a lightness of 64.7%. #7077da color hex could be obtained by blending #e0eeff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#7077da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7077da has RGB values of R:112, G:119,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 7370714.

Shades and Tints of #7077da
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03040d is the darkest color, while #fcf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#7077da
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a0a1aa is the less saturated color, while #4d59fd is the most saturated one.
